According to UnivDatos, the India Short-Haul Aircraft Market is expected to reach a market size of USD 200 million by 2024, with a CAGR of 18.45% from 2025 to 2033. Sustained domestic passenger growth, government-led regional connectivity, and the addition of new routes are some of the key drivers supporting the market rise.

Airbus:          

Airbus SE, together with its subsidiaries, engages in the design, manufacture, and delivery of aeronautics and aerospace products, services, and solutions worldwide. It operates through three segments: Airbus, Airbus Helicopters, and Airbus Defence and Space. The Airbus segment develops, manufactures, markets, and sells commercial jet passenger aircraft, freighter aircraft, regional turboprop aircraft, and aircraft components, as well as provides aircraft conversion and related services. The Airbus Helicopters segment develops, manufactures, markets, and sells civil and military helicopters and provides helicopter-related services. The Airbus Defence and Space segment designs, develops, delivers, and supports manned and unmanned military air systems and related services. This segment also offers civil and defence space systems for telecommunications, earth observations, navigation, and science and orbital systems; missile and space launcher systems; and services around data processing from platforms, secure communication, and cyber security. The company was formerly known as Airbus Group SE and changed its name to Airbus SE in April 2017. The company was incorporated in 1998 and is headquartered in Leiden, the Netherlands. Airbus offers a large number of regional as well as narrowbody aircraft widely used in commercial aviation. These aircraft include A318, A319, A320, A321, A320neo, etc., which are widely used across the globe.

Boeing:

The Boeing Company, together with its subsidiaries, designs, develops, manufactures, sells, services, and supports commercial jetliners, military aircraft, satellites, missile defense, human space flight and launch systems, and services worldwide. The company operates through three segments: Commercial Airplanes, Defense, Space & Security, and Global Services. The Commercial Airplanes segment develops, produces, and markets commercial jet aircraft for passenger and cargo requirements. The Defense, Space & Security segment engages in the research, development, production, and modification of manned and unmanned military aircraft and weapons systems; strategic defense and intelligence systems, which include strategic missile and defense systems, command, control, communications, computers, intelligence, surveillance and reconnaissance, cyber and information solutions, and intelligence systems; and satellite systems, such as government and commercial satellites, and space exploration. The Global Services segment offers products and services, including supply chain and logistics management, engineering, maintenance and modifications, upgrades and conversions, spare parts, pilot and maintenance training systems and services, technical and maintenance documents, and data analytics and digital services to commercial and defense customers. The Boeing Company was incorporated in 1916 and is based in Arlington, Virginia. Boeing is also a key player in offering narrowbody aircraft widely used for short-haul operations, such as Boeing 737 Max, older 757, etc.

ATR:

GIE Avions de Transport Régional manufactures and sells turboprop aircraft. It provides aircraft for transportation, commercial, and private use. Additionally, the company also offers spare support, training, maintenance, technical, and E-services for aircraft. GIE Avions de Transport Régional was founded in 1981 and is based in Blagnac, France. GIE Avions de Transport Régional is a joint venture of Airbus SE and Leonardo S.p.a. A wide number of short-haul turboprop-based aircraft are being offered by ATR under its ATR 72 series and ATR 42 series.

Embraer:

Embraer S.A., together with its subsidiaries, designs, develops, manufactures, and sells aircraft and systems worldwide. It operates through Commercial Aviation, Defense & Security, Executive Aviation, Services & Support, and other segments. The Commercial Aviation segment develops, produces, and sells commercial jets. Its Defense & Security segment develops and produces military aircraft and radars; and is involved in research and development of software and integrated information systems, communications, border monitoring and surveillance, space systems/satellites, and aircraft modernization services and support, as well as command, control, communications, computer, intelligence, surveillance, and reconnaissance systems. The Executive Aviation segment develops, produces, and sells executive jets. Its Service & Support segment provides field and technical support, flight operations solutions, aircraft modification, materials management, maintenance solutions, and training programs. The Other segment engages in the supply of structural parts and hydraulic systems; production of agricultural crop-spraying aircraft; development and certification of eVTOLs; creation of a maintenance and service network, and air traffic control system for eVTOLs; development and manufacture of electrical propulsion systems; cybersecurity; and software and technical products. Additionally, the company is involved in leasing used aircraft; pilot, mechanic, and crew training; engineering services; retail trade, maintenance, and repair of computer products; information technology consulting, data processing, application service providers, and internet hosting; and fabrication of aircraft interiors. The company was formerly known as Embraer-Empresa Brasileira de Aeronáutica S.A. and changed its name to Embraer S.A. in November 2010. Embraer offers a wide range of business and executive-class aircraft, such as PHENOM 100EX, PHENOM 300E, PRAETOR 500, etc.
